Based on our analysis of NIST CSF 2.0 coverage, core features, company size fit, deployment model, here is our conclusion:
SMB and mid-market teams managing on-premises or hybrid Active Directory environments need UserLock for context-aware access control that blocks compromised credentials even after MFA bypass. The tool maps directly to NIST PR.AA by enforcing device posture and location checks before granting logon, not just at initial authentication. Skip this if your infrastructure is cloud-native or you lack Active Directory as a core identity system; UserLock's value collapses without AD to anchor on.
Mid-market and enterprise teams with hybrid infrastructure,on-premises Active Directory plus cloud apps,should evaluate OneLogin Virtual LDAP Service for its ability to extend directory authentication to network devices without rebuilding infrastructure. The managed cloud LDAP eliminates installation overhead while supporting NAS, VPN, and WiFi auth alongside multifactor authentication, addressing the real problem of authenticating non-cloud resources without maintaining separate directory systems. Skip this if your environment is purely cloud-native or if you need deep audit logging and granular access policies beyond what LDAP interfaces provide.
